
JAX -- the Java Application eXtractor
JAX (short for "Jikes Application eXtractor")
is an application extraction tool for Java that reduces the program's size.
JAX extracts the necessary classes, methods, and fields from a Java application
(or applet), applies some optimizations and compression techniques. We
measured size reductions ranging from 30% to 80% on real-life Java applications,
where the larger size reductions generally occur for large, library-based
applications. We have succesfully used JAX on applications of up to 2000
classes.
